Investor confidence in Taiwan has rebounded marginally from a record low in the third quarter, but there is still some worry about the country’s economic outlook, according to a report released by JPMorgan Asset Management Taiwan Tuesday.
Taiwan’s investor confidence index rose to 83 in the fourth quarter of the year from a record low of 81.7 in the previous quarter, thanks to improving sentiment toward the performance of the local stock market and the political and investment environment, said Alex Chio, executive director of the company.
A figure above 100 indicates positive sentiment toward the investment environment, while a number below 100 indicates pessimism, according to the company. [FULL STORY]
